GD32L233系列芯片IAR/Keil插件安装指南

需积分: 50 16 下载量 34 浏览量 更新于2024-12-21 收藏 1.84MB 7Z 举报
资源摘要信息:"GD32L233芯片插件包" 知识点概述: 本文介绍了一款针对GD32L233系列芯片的插件包,该插件包用于解决在主流集成开发环境IAR和Keil中缺少对应芯片支持的问题。通过提供必要的软件组件,开发者可以在这些开发环境中顺利地进行GD32L233系列单片机的编程和调试工作。 GD32L233芯片概述: GD32L233属于兆易创新(GigaDevice)公司推出的GD32系列微控制器产品线。GD32L23x系列是基于ARM®Cortex®-M4内核的32位高性能微控制器,具有丰富的外设接口和低功耗设计。这些特性使得该系列芯片非常适合用于工业控制、电机驱动、传感器集成以及物联网等领域。 软件开发环境支持: IAR Embedded Workbench和Keil MDK-ARM是两款广泛使用的集成开发环境,它们支持多种ARM Cortex-M系列微控制器的开发。然而,并非所有芯片系列在发行初期都会立即获得这些开发工具的支持。因此,芯片制造商或第三方开发者可能会发布相应的插件包,以补充开发工具的不足,确保开发者能够使用他们习惯的开发环境。 插件包内容与使用: 本次提供的“GD32L233芯片插件包”包含了一系列特定于GD32L233系列芯片的软件组件。这些组件包括但不限于:启动文件、外设库、配置文件以及示例工程等。开发者在IAR或Keil中安装此插件包后,应能够直接创建和管理GD32L233系列芯片的项目。 插件包的安装步骤通常包括: 1. 下载对应的插件包文件(例如GD32L23x_AddOn_V1.0.0)。 2. 解压缩文件到指定文件夹。 3. 打开IAR或Keil开发环境。 4. 通过开发环境的插件安装向导进行插件包的导入和安装。 5. 重启开发环境,以确保插件被正确加载。 6. 创建新的项目或打开现有项目,并选择GD32L233系列芯片进行编译和调试。 单片机与嵌入式硬件开发: GD32L233芯片属于嵌入式硬件范畴,嵌入式硬件是指专为特定应用而设计的计算机系统,它们通常嵌入到更大系统中,执行特定的控制或监视任务。嵌入式硬件的开发是一个跨学科领域,涉及硬件设计、固件编程、系统集成以及性能优化等各个方面。 ARM架构的优势: ARM架构的微控制器由于其低功耗、高性能以及丰富的生态系统支持,在嵌入式领域占据着重要的地位。ARM Cortex-M系列提供了一系列从简单的Cortex-M0到更加强大的Cortex-M4的内核,满足了不同复杂度应用的需求。GD32L233所采用的Cortex-M4内核提供了浮点计算能力和更高级的性能,使其能够处理复杂的任务。 总结: 对于想要开发基于GD32L233系列单片机应用的工程师来说,“GD32L233芯片插件包”的推出极大地方便了他们的工作。通过简单的安装流程,即可在IAR或Keil开发环境中获得对GD32L233系列的支持,从而利用这些强大的工具来完成项目的开发与调试工作。